Subject: CVE request: kernel: Unix sockets kernel panic
Hi,
We need a CVE name for this issue. This was reported in netdev today.
"The following code causes a kernel panic on Linux 2.6.26:
http://darkircop.org/unix.c
I haven't investigated the bug so I'm not sure what is causing it, and
don't know if it's exploitable. The code passes unix sockets from one
process to another using unix sockets. The bug probably has to do
with closing file descriptors."
